Delta receives three silvers from Brandon Hall Group's HCM Excellence Awards 2021
Human Resource Management Division 2021/10

Brandon Hall Groups’ HCM Excellence Awards Program is one of the most recognized and respected research organizations in the field of human resources. This year (2021), Delta won three silver medals in the categories of Best Unique or Innovative Talent Management Solution, Best Use of Video for Learning, and Best Learning Team.

In the "Best Learning Team" and "Best Use of Video for Learning" categories, Delta was recognized for its efforts in identifying and cultivating the key talents needed for the future, actively strengthening the digital capabilities of its employees, and significantly enhancing the benefits of knowledge sharing and dissemination in response to its digital transformation strategy.

To stand firm and seize new opportunities in the wave of digitization, Delta first initiated the transformation of its functions and strengthened the framework for developing and cultivating talent with a "nurture by nature" method. Delta then created a digital learning solution to promote the convenience and immediacy of knowledge diffusion. At the same time, Delta targeted and assisted the key talents skilled at problem-solving in development and transformation. Delta's global learning development team has successfully helped the Group achieve the goals of continuous revenue growth, digitally transforming talent cultivation, and brand value enhancement year by year.
 

In promoting digital learning, Delta has developed a series of e-learning solutions that allow employees or the public to learn through various online platforms, such as DeltaMOOCx, Academy, or a mobile app. Users can easily learn and track their learning progress without time or geographical restrictions, effectively reducing the time and cost of training, thereby allowing Delta to fulfill its corporate social responsibility and prepare for the cultivation of automated talents beforehand.

To accelerated the strategic transformation of the organization, Delta has also mapped out a three-year project plan for the development of new talent, cultivating them into an engine that will power corporate transformation. The results have been recognized in the "Best Unique or Innovative Talent Management Program." In 2019, Delta selected dozens of new talents from around the globe and has successfully assisted 42% of these new talents to join the business solution team to plan and execute development events with their "cross-domain" and "sales" capabilities. In 2020, the Shadowing program allowed new talents to step out of their original fields and participate in business solution projects they have never experienced before. Senior experts were also arranged to mentor the participants, accelerating the talents to become one of the forces behind the company's transformation through "training," "experience," and "practice."
